Job Summary
The Service Center at the Tennessee Board of Regents (TBR) supports the System Office and Technical Colleges of Applied Technology (TCATs) within the following functional areas: Human Resources Payroll Finance Procurement & Payment Services and Student.
The Associate Payroll is responsible for ensuring all payroll compensation is provided in a timely and accurate manner and in compliance with all applicable institutional TBR Federal and State regulations policies and guidelines. The Associate Payroll executes and audits complex payroll transactions utilizing sophisticated technology in support of providing professional services. The Associate Payroll works closely with the TCATs and the System Office and is expected to provide a high level of customer service to all institutions served.

Minimum Qualifications
Bachelors degree and a minimum of 2 years of related professional work experience OR a high school degree/GED and a minimum of 5 years of related professional work experience OR a comparable combination of education and experience
Experience or training in Windows operating system and Microsoft applications
Preferred Qualifications
Experience working in payroll in a college university or state government setting
Experience within a shared services operating environment
Experience with Banner or similar ERP system
Experience with Edison
Knowledge Skills and Abilities
Knowledge of payroll terminology practices and basic accounting theory and practice
Ability to perform payroll related calculations
Broad knowledge of federal and state laws and guidelines
A willingness and passion to learn new hardware and software systems that are consistent with duties
Ability to effectively analyze data and inquiries think critically and make appropriate decisions
Effective organizational and time management skills
Ability to work as part of a team or work alone without close supervision
Strong interpersonal skills
Ability to communicate effectively both in writing and orally
Ability to understand customer needs and provide quality service
Ability to maintain confidentiality in compliance rules and regulations including HIPAA and FERPA guidelines on the disclosure of information
